(a) A restricted commercial driver's license may be issued to persons without meeting the required knowledge and skill tests for driving a commercial motor vehicle prescribed in § 17E-1-9 of this code who are employees of the following designated farm-related service industries:
(1) Agrichemical businesses;
(2) Custom harvesters;
(3) Farm retail outlets and suppliers; and
(4) Livestock feeders.
(b) A restricted commercial driver's license issued pursuant to this section shall meet all of the requirements and restrictions set forth in 49 C.F.R. § 383.3(f), including any seasonal periods defined by the commissioner.
